Your Hotel Website is No Longer Your Most Important Digital Asset
In 2026, your revenue won’t be shaped by how beautiful your homepage looks. It will be shaped by how AI summarizes you.
Right now, ChatGPT, Google AI, and Perplexity are generating 1–2 sentence descriptions of your property. These summaries are doing the heavy lifting before a guest ever clicks a link. They:
-
Decide if you make the shortlist.
-
Frame your strengths (and highlight your weaknesses).
-
Influence who even considers booking with you.
The “AI Shadow”
This summary is your AI Shadow. It’s not what you say about your hotel; it’s what the internet tells AI about you.
With 60% of searches already resulting in zero-clicks, more potential guests will see this AI summary than your actual website. Discovery is being mediated, and if your positioning is vague or inconsistent, AI fills the gaps—often inaccurately.
How to Feed the Machine: The C.A.R.B.S. Framework
You can’t “control” your AI Shadow in the traditional sense, but you can influence it. To ensure AI recommends you correctly, you must feed it C.A.R.B.S.:
-
Clear positioning: Define exactly who you are for, so the AI doesn’t have to guess.
-
Authority signals: High-quality backlinks and mentions from reputable travel sources.
-
Reviews: Consistent, recent sentiment across platforms like TripAdvisor and Google.
-
Brand consistency: Ensuring your story is the same on your site, OTAs, and social media.
-
Stronger machine readability: Using schema markup and structured data so AI “crawlers” understand your facts.

Test Your Property Today
The era of “ranking” is fading; the era of being correctly summarized has begun. If you are a GM, Marketing Director, or Owner, I encourage you to ask an AI tool these three questions today:
-
“What type of guest is this hotel best for?”
-
“What are the most common complaints about this property?”
-
“Why might someone choose this hotel over its top three competitors?”
The answer you get is exactly what the market is seeing.
